What I Ate: Petit Crenn

Petit Crenn - Hayes Valley

Petit Crenn may be my new favorite restaurant in San Francisco. From the dreamy white decor to the rustic french bites the dining experience at Petit Crenn is one of a kind.

Lucky for me I had the chance to dine at Petit Crenn on a beautiful Friday afternoon with some of my favorite food and fashion bloggers in San Francisco. We chatted about dating (insert all the awful Tinder stories) over some several bottles of sparkling wine while dining on the perfect mix of light bites.

Petit Crenn is open Tuesday through Sunday. Lunch is served with or without a reservation from 11 am – 2 pm. Dinner is served a la carte at the Chef’s Counter without a reservation from 5 – 10 pm Tuesday through Saturday.
